Patrushev said about the dismissal of more than 60 Crimean bureaucrats
Russia's security Council Secretary Nikolai Patrushev said at a visiting meeting on problems of counteraction to threats of national security in Crimea, more than 60 bureaucrats on the Peninsula were fired for bribery.
"Widespread lawlessness associated with the organization of criminal schemes of state and municipal property ", - summed up Patrushev.
according to his statement, " in connection with corruption in the Republic of Crimea dismissed from their posts for more than 60 officials, as well as among them from the highest bodies of Executive power ", reports RIA " Novosti ". Patrushev said that it is necessary to take more serious measures to combat crime and corruption, improve the personnel policy in the bodies of state power and bodies of local self-government of the Republic of Crimea and Sevastopol. The Secretary of security Council of Russia believes that to improve the situation, Also need to carefully choose the candidates for the positions of state and civil servants and more tightly to keep control of their activities. Patrushev said that in General, registered in the Crimea, about seven hundred of crimes of corruption. Also at the meeting he said about the growing terrorist threat from nationalists and terrorists." The development of the Republic of Crimea will be determined largely by low productivity of public administration. This is largely due to the fact that at the state level until not formed the strategic Development of the region. Adopted documents do not define the key priorities of development of the Crimea", - has summed up Patrushev. Remember, March 16, 2014 Crimea held a referendum on the status of autonomy, more than 96% of participants who were in favor of joining region in Russia. On March 21, Russian President Vladimir Putin signed the law on ratification of the agreement on joining of the Crimea and Sevastopol a part of Russia, as well as the decree about formation of the Crimean Federal district.
